CTR had way better tracks, control, and play dynamics than MK, even though it was an outstanding game. CTR allowed you to upgrade your items, gave you complete control of your kart in aerial situations, and gave you boosts for constant speed.
CTR just took the formula and crushed the barriers, but I love the Mario Kart series something fierce.
